DHM this is not a difficult little bag to make just have to pin very carefully when attaching the lid and base, the rest is pretty straight forward. The pattern is from a book called Fabulous Fat Quarter Bags and it is called a Mini Pochette, I made mine a little larger to fit all my stuff in and I used extra stiff wadding so it won't collapse
